What pick was lebron in the drafts?

He was the number one pick overall, by Cleveland, in 2003.

What does PRK and ADP mean in ESPN Fantasy Basketball?

In ESPN Fantasy Basketball, PRK refers to "Rank," which indicates a player's overall standing based on their performance in the league. ADP stands for "Average Draft Position," reflecting the average spot where a player is typically selected in drafts across various leagues, helping managers gauge when to target specific players. Both metrics are useful for strategizing during drafts and managing rosters.


What are different types of draft?

Drafts can refer to various contexts, including writing and business. In writing, there are several types of drafts: rough drafts, which are initial versions that capture ideas; revision drafts, which incorporate changes and improvements; and final drafts, which are polished and ready for publication. In finance, drafts refer to written orders for payment, such as bank drafts or promissory notes. Additionally, in sports, drafts are processes by which teams select players from a pool, typically seen in leagues like the NFL or NBA.

Does an nfl player have to accept the team that drafts him?

No. A team that drafts a player has one year to sign that player to a contract. If the team cannot sign the player because the player does not want to play for them, the team may trade the player to another team. If a drafted player has not signed a contract within one year of being drafted, that player may enter the draft again and be selected again.

What do drafts mean about a building?

Drafts may mean the doors and windows do not fit properly and wind is coming in.
